IAALS Resources Reflect Importance of Centering Children in Divorce Proceedings

Legal Tech Monitor

By encouraging parents to prioritize effective communication, collaboration, and cooperation, courts can do their best to ensure that the needs and feelings of their children are addressed throughout the process. Various ADR resources are available to courts seeking to make divorce as uncontentious as possible.
